Congressional Summary of HR 5753
Healthy Meals Help Kids Learn Act of 2025
This bill permanently increases the federal reimbursement rates for the school lunch and breakfast programs of the Department of Agriculture.
Specifically, beginning November 1, 2025, the bill provides an additional 45 cents per lunch served in the National School Lunch Program and an additional 28 cents per breakfast served in the School Breakfast Program. These amounts must be adjusted annually for inflation beginning July 1, 2026.

Current Status of Bill HR 5753
Bill HR 5753 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since October 14, 2025. Bill HR 5753 was introduced during Congress 119 and was introduced to the House on October 14, 2025. Bill HR 5753's most recent activity was Referred to the House Committee on Education and Workforce. as of October 14, 2025
